The problem with the comparison between Minecraft and Super Mario Maker isn't anything to do with it being a level editor or whatever else anybody's saying. I think the game in and of itself really does have phenomenal potential to be a hit - it's not just a level editor, it's a level editor of the most iconic character in gaming and looks exceptionally easy to use whilst still having a good amount of potential.

The problem is that Minecraft was on a platform that pretty much everybody owns. When I bought Minecraft Alpha it cost me £6 ($10). You really think millions of people are going to make the $300ish investment to buy a Wii U and Super Mario Maker?
